The after-tax 401 (k) … Nettet21. mar. 2024 · Unless it is a Roth 401 (k) account, you will pay income taxes on withdrawals from a 401 (k) regardless of age. This is because while adding to this account, taxes were not paid. You added to it on a tax-deferred basis. Taxes are only deferred for as long as the money remains in the account. The IRS allows penalty-free withdrawals from retirement accounts after age 59 ½and requires withdrawals after age 72 (these are called Required Minimum Distributions, or RMDs). Se mer A withdrawal you make from a 401(k) after you retire is officially known as a distribution. NettetHow much tax do I pay on 401k withdrawal at 59 1 2? Understanding qualified distributions You may withdraw as much money from the account as you'd like once you reach this age. When you take a qualified distribution from a 401(k) after the age of 59 1/2, you are taxed at your ordinary income tax rate.
